The Chess Confederation for America (CCA), the Brazilian Chess Federation (CBX) and the Federação Catarinense de Xadrez (FCX) are pleased to invite all the national chess federations of the American continent, to the XIV Pan American School Chess Championship 2025 that will be held in Florianópolis, Santa Catarina – Brazil, from August 30th to September 5th, 2025.

Participants and Categories

The event will be divided into twelve (12) categories as follows:

• Category U07 Open (born on January 1st, 2018 or after);
• Category U07 Girls (born on January 1st, 2018 or after);
• Category U09 Open (born on January 1st, 2016 or after);
• Category U09 Girls (born on January 1st, 2016 or after);
• Category U11 Open (born on January 1st, 2014 or after);
• Category U11 Girls (born on January 1st, 2014 or after);
• Category U13 Open (born on January 1st, 2012 or after);
• Category U13 Girls (born on January 1st, 2012 or after);
• Category U15 Open (born on January 1st, 2010 or after);
• Category U15 Girls (born on January 1st, 2010 or after);
• Category U17 Open (born on January 1st, 2008 or after);
• Category U17 Girls (born on January 1st, 2008 or after).

Official Players: Will be considered as official players as defenders of their titles, if eligibles:

• The champions of each category of XIII Pan American School Chess Championship 2024, disputed in Paraguay;
• The champions of each category of the last Central American and Caribbean School Chess Festival 2024, disputed in Honduras;
• The champions of the South American School Chess Championship 2024, disputed in Peru;

Official players must be informed to the organization by the national federations until June 30th, 2025. The registration is only confirmed after payment of the due fees. The organization is 100% responsible for food and lodging for official players from August 30th (dinner) to September 6th (breakfast).

Extra Players: Every Federation may register the number of unofficial players it wishes without restriction, who must cover their registration, transfer, accommodation and registration expenses.
